4.5.4 Replace the membrane cap
When the DO electrode’s response time becomes slower, obvious errors occur in
measurement, or when the sensitive membrane of DO electrode is wrinkled, cracked or
damaged at any extent (the well-functioning membrane surface should look perfectly
smooth), it’s time to replace a new membrane cap (DO503) according to the following steps.
a) Screw off the membrane cap;
b) Rinse off the electrode without membrane cap with distilled water and shake off
excess water.
c) Clean on the cathode surface (gold slice) with a clean tissue or kimwipe;
d) Add new inner solution (DO502) into a new membrane cap (DO503) slowly and do
not let any air bubbles appear. If you found any air bubbles in the cap, carefully flick
on the membrane cap to eliminate them.
e) Place the membrane cap on the table and put in the electrode vertically, slowly twist
in, and then screw on the cap tightly. The excess inner solution will be squeezed out.
Please wipe it off with tissue and rinse off the electrode in distilled water.
f) Check if there are any air bubbles in electrolyte (except for the smaller air bubbles),
If so, re-assembly is needed.
g) Do not touch the sensitive membrane with fingers directly because the sweat and
grease will affect the quality of the membrane.
4.6 Zero Oxygen Calibration
Usually there is no need to do zero oxygen calibration unless you have a high requirement
for accuracy in low oxygen level (<1.0 ppm). To do zero oxygen calibration, follow the steps
below:
Prepare 100mL of zero-oxygen water: In a 100 mL beaker, add in 5.0 g anhydrous sodium
sulfite (Na
2
SO
3
); add 100 mL distilled water; mix well to dissolve. Not that the zero-oxygen
water is only effective within 24 hours.
